What is an orthopedic surgeon?

The intricate framework of the human body, encompassing bones, joints, ligaments, tendons, and muscles, collectively forms the musculoskeletal system. These components facilitate daily movements, making their well-being essential. Orthopedics is a branch of health science that deals with their care.

While an orthopedic surgeon's skill set includes surgical interventions, their proficiency extends to offering diagnosis and treatment through various modalities. Many orthopedic specialists may also choose to subspecialize, i.e., become experts in a specific area of orthopedics. Hand surgery, foot disorders, and sports-related injuries are some examples of fields an orthopedic surgeon may focus on.

An orthopedic surgeon's involvement in a patient's case typically begins with a primary care practitioner's referral. However, one may also visit them on their own accord if needed. 


Education and training

Becoming eligible to practice as an orthopedic surgeon in the United States demands rigorous education and training spanning 13 to 14 years. This journey involves:


  • Completing a four-year-long undergraduate program at a college or university
  • Attending a four-year-long medical school program
  • Completing a focused five-year-long orthopedic surgery residency
  • Acquiring optional subspecialization through a year-long fellowship in various orthopedic subspecialties. 

Finally, candidates must pass a certifying examination by the American Board of Orthopedic Surgery or the American Osteopathic Board of Orthopedic Surgery to attain board certification. Renewing certification every decade requires continuing education courses and exams, which helps maintain sustained expertise. 


What are some common orthopedic subspecialties?

Orthopedics is a broad field of medicine. The most common orthopedic subspecialties that it encompasses include the following:


  • Pediatric orthopedics


Pediatric orthopedics focuses on musculoskeletal injuries and disorders in infants, children, and adolescents. These experts can treat or manage issues like broken bones, cerebral palsy, scoliosis, etc. Pediatric orthopedists better understand a child's musculoskeletal development and provide appropriate treatment that does not hinder the child's growth.


  • Sports medicine


The subspecialty focuses on treating sports-related injuries and disorders affecting the musculoskeletal system. These experts help improve performance and apply exercise and physical therapy to treat injury and maximize mobility.


  • Spine surgery


Spine surgery deals with injuries and disorders affecting the spinal cord due to degeneration, trauma, or diseases.


  • Hand surgery


The hand surgery subspecialty focuses on treating disorders affecting the hand and upper extremities. These conditions could include fractures, carpal tunnel syndrome, and trigger fingers.


  • Joint replacement


This subspecialty treats worn-out or damaged joints caused by wear and tear, overuse, or aging. Joint replacement surgeons most commonly perform knee and hip replacements.


  • Podiatry (foot and ankle)


The podiatry subspecialty focuses on identifying and treating foot and ankle conditions. These could include sprains and strains, Achilles tendons, or diabetes-related foot disorders. 


  • Trauma surgery


Orthopedic surgeons specializing in trauma surgery treat critical or severe musculoskeletal injuries or conditions in the trauma unit. These experts can conduct immediate essential procedures in accidental trauma and injury cases.


What does an orthopedic surgeon do?

Within the domain of orthopedic care, an orthopedic surgeon focuses on the following:

  • Diagnosing a broad array of conditions affecting the musculoskeletal system and treating them
  • Guiding patients' rehabilitation process to restore movement, range of motion, strength, and flexibility after injury or surgery
  • Crafting strategic frameworks to avert injuries or mitigate chronic disorders' progression, such as arthritis

Through their multifaceted roles, orthopedic surgeons are guardians of your musculoskeletal well-being, employing their comprehensive knowledge and skills to enhance your quality of life.

Ways to build strong and healthy bones

Orthopedic surgeons emphasize maintaining bone density to prevent fractures and osteoporosis. Individuals can strengthen their bones effectively by adopting the following strategies:

  • Engage in strength training and weight-bearing exercises: Weight-bearing exercises promote bone formation, while strength training increases muscle mass, reducing fracture risk in older adults.
  • Prioritize high-calcium foods: Calcium is the most crucial mineral for bone health. A daily calcium intake of 1,000–1,300 mg can help maintain bone strength. Food sources are preferable to supplements, as excessive supplementation may increase the risk of heart disease.
  • Ensure adequate vitamin D and K intake: Vitamin D aids calcium absorption, while vitamin K2 helps bind minerals to bones. Sun exposure and foods like fish, liver, and cheese provide these vitamins.
  • Consume sufficient protein: Protein makes up 50% of bone structure. Adequate intake supports calcium absorption and bone formation. A balanced diet with 3.5 ounces of protein daily is recommended.
  • Eat plenty of vegetables: Vegetables are great sources of vitamin C, which helps stimulate bone-forming cells. Green and yellow vegetables can enhance bone mineralization in children and help maintain bone mass in adults.
  • Avoid very low-calorie diets: Eating fewer than 1,000 calories daily reduces bone density. A well-balanced diet, including at least 1,200 calories, promotes bone health.
  • Consider collagen supplements: Collagen contains amino acids essential for bone strength and may help relieve joint pain.
  • Increase magnesium and zinc intake: Magnesium converts vitamin D into a form that helps promote calcium absorption, while zinc encourages bone-building cells. Nuts, seeds, and seafood provide these minerals.
  • Eat omega-3 fatty acid-rich foods: Omega-3s protect against bone loss and are found in fatty fish, flaxseeds, and walnuts.
  • Maintain a stable, healthy weight: Both low body weight and obesity can weaken bones. Stable weight management is crucial for bone health.

Statistics on arthritis and orthopedic surgeons in Long Island, NY

Data from the Behavioral Risk Factor Surveillance System (BRFSS) underscore that women exhibit a higher age-adjusted prevalence of arthritis than men across all states.

The Information for Action Report of 2020-21 concluded that Seneca, Washington, Hamilton, Essex, and Wayne were the five counties with the highest arthritis prevalence across the country. In contrast, Tompkins, Queens, New York, Kings, and Nassau ranked as the counties with the lowest majority. Notably, New York County registered an arthritis prevalence of approximately 17.7%.

According to the 2022 data published by America's Health Rankings, approximately 24% of adults in New York had arthritis, lower than the U.S. average of about 28%. Almost 49% of adults in the 65+ age group in New York had arthritis, lower than the U.S. average of about 53%. 

New York women (28%) are more susceptible to arthritis than men (20%). Arthritis prevalence is higher in the non-metro areas of New York than in the metro areas, approximately 31% and 24%, respectively. 

As per a U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ics report, New York is the second-highest employment hub for orthopedic surgeons, excluding pediatrics, after California. The state houses around 2,050 employed orthopedic surgeons, boasting a location quotient of about 1.75. These skilled professionals operate predominantly from physician offices, contributing to a nationwide employment tally of roughly 15,830.
